International law firm Bryan Cave Leighton Paisner (BCLP) has welcomed new Real Estate Partner Wayne Ma to the firm’s Hong Kong office. Wayne’s arrival marks the 10th lateral hire to join the practice in the past year, as BCLP continues to strengthen its market-leading position in the international commercial real estate arena. Joining from DLA Piper, Wayne has more than 14 years’ experience in Asia on a wide variety of real estate transactions, including acquisitions and dispositions of various types of real property, joint ventures, limited recourse and secured financings, private equity and institutional investments, and funds formation.

Dentons Hong Kong is pleased to announce that Vivien Teu will join Dentons Hong Kong as a Partner for the Investment Funds and Corporate practice areas. Vivien will be Head of Asset Management and ESG, with her focus advising regional and global asset managers and financial institutions on legal and regulatory matters in asset management and diverse forms of investment funds, and on corporate and regulatory issues around environmental, social, and corporate governance (ESG) and sustainable finance. Vivien is currently Managing Partner of Vivien Teu & Co LLP, a Hong Kong firm with established reputation particularly in the areas of asset management, investment funds, securities regulatory and wealth management.

Morrison & Foerster, a leading global law firm, is pleased to announce that Chen Zhu has joined the firm’s Hong Kong office as a partner in its global Investigations + White Collar Defense practice. He brings to the firm extensive experience in cross-border government enforcement and internal investigations involving U.S. economic sanctions, anti-corruption, securities fraud, and corporate compliance matters. Zhu joins the firm from Davis Polk & Wardwell LLP.
